Manchester's Caribbean Carnival is more than just a festival—it's a vibrant celebration of unity, diversity, and cultural pride. Every year, the city comes alive with the sounds of calypso, reggae, and soca, as colourful costumes and joyful crowds fill the streets.

A Fusion of Cultures

The carnival, deeply rooted in Caribbean traditions, has become a symbol of Manchester's multicultural identity. It showcases the rich heritage of the Caribbean community while inviting people from all backgrounds to join in the festivities.

Music, Dance, and Community Spirit

From steel bands to energetic dance performances, the event is a feast for the senses. Local artists and international acts share the stage, creating an unforgettable experience for attendees.

A Vision of Harmony

Organisers emphasise the carnival's role in fostering social cohesion. "We are diverse cultures coming together," says one participant. "This is where Manchester truly shines—as a city that embraces everyone."

Economic and Social Impact

Beyond its cultural significance, the carnival boosts local businesses and tourism. Street vendors offer Caribbean delicacies, while artisans sell handmade crafts, contributing to the city's economy.

As the event grows each year, its message of unity resonates louder, proving that celebrations like these are vital in building stronger, more inclusive communities.
